After several reviews of our close to 1000 posts in 2011, we’ve decided to put together 100/2011- an e-zine showcasing our favourite photographs we posted this year.
BOTY is curated by three photographers who all have distinctly different aesthetic preferences, both in their own work and in others. This zine reflects those differences, all while maintaining a cohesive sense of what, exactly, we take in to account while curating projects.
As we’ve recently celebrated the release of our 50th zine, it’s also nice to know that this week also marks our three year anniversary of working together as an independent publishing house. Pretty crazy to think our first zine, Girls, was just getting started at this time in 2008.
